国产成人毛片视频|星空传媒久草视频|欧美激情草久视频|久久久久女女|久操超碰在线播放|亚洲强奸一区二区|五月天丁香社区在线|色婷婷成人丁香网|午夜欧美6666|纯肉无码91视频

JS圖片壓縮方法

1. urltoImage(url, fn) 通過一個url加載所需的圖片對象,其中url參數(shù)傳入圖片的url,fn為回調(diào)方法,包含一個Image對象的參數(shù)。 2. imagetoCanvas(i

1. urltoImage(url, fn)

通過一個url加載所需的圖片對象,其中url參數(shù)傳入圖片的url,fn為回調(diào)方法,包含一個Image對象的參數(shù)。

2. imagetoCanvas(image)

將一個Image對象轉(zhuǎn)換為一個Canvas類型對象,其中image參數(shù)傳入一個Image對象。

3. canvasResizetoFile(canvas, quality, fn)

將一個Canvas對象壓縮轉(zhuǎn)換為一個Blob類型對象。其中canvas參數(shù)傳入一個Canvas對象,quality參數(shù)傳入一個0-1的數(shù)值,表示圖片壓縮質(zhì)量。fn為回調(diào)方法,包含一個Blob對象的參數(shù)。

4. canvasResizetoDataURL(canvas, quality)

將一個Canvas對象壓縮轉(zhuǎn)換為一個dataURL字符串。其中canvas參數(shù)傳入一個Canvas對象,quality參數(shù)傳入一個0-1的數(shù)值。

5. filetoDataURL(file, fn)

將File(Blob)類型文件轉(zhuǎn)換為dataURL字符串。其中file參數(shù)傳入一個File(Blob)類型文件,fn為回調(diào)方法,包含一個dataURL字符串的參數(shù)。

6. dataURLtoImage(dataurl, fn)

將一串dataURL字符串轉(zhuǎn)換為Image類型文件。其中dataurl參數(shù)傳入一個dataURL字符串,fn為回調(diào)方法,包含一個Image類型文件的參數(shù)。

7. dataURLtoFile(dataurl)

將一串dataURL字符串轉(zhuǎn)換為Blob類型對象。其中dataurl參數(shù)傳入一個dataURL字符串。

圖片壓縮的重要性

隨著互聯(lián)網(wǎng)的發(fā)展,圖片在網(wǎng)頁中扮演著越來越重要的角色。然而,大尺寸的高清圖片會導(dǎo)致網(wǎng)頁加載速度變慢,用戶體驗下降。因此,對圖片進(jìn)行壓縮是提高網(wǎng)頁性能和用戶體驗的重要步驟之一。

JS圖片壓縮方法的應(yīng)用

使用JS圖片壓縮方法可以輕松地在前端實現(xiàn)對圖片的壓縮處理。通過將圖片轉(zhuǎn)換為Canvas對象,然后調(diào)整壓縮質(zhì)量或尺寸,最后再轉(zhuǎn)換為Blob對象或dataURL字符串,從而實現(xiàn)對圖片的壓縮和優(yōu)化。

注意事項

在使用JS圖片壓縮方法時,需要注意以下幾點:

  1. 選擇合適的壓縮質(zhì)量,以兼顧圖片的清晰度和文件大小。
  2. 在壓縮大尺寸圖片時,避免過高的壓縮比例,以免導(dǎo)致圖片失真。
  3. 根據(jù)實際需求,選擇合適的壓縮方法和參數(shù)。

總結(jié)

通過使用JS圖片壓縮方法,我們可以輕松地在前端實現(xiàn)對圖片的壓縮和優(yōu)化,提高網(wǎng)頁加載速度和用戶體驗。合理選擇壓縮質(zhì)量和方法,可以在保持圖片清晰度的同時,減小文件大小。

標(biāo)簽: